“I became an ENT physician to help people live better lives. From sinus disorders reducing our ability to smell and taste to voice and hearing problems reducing our ability to communicate with loved ones, ENT disorders can have a profound effect on our quality of life. As an otolaryngologist, I have the privilege of helping patients through these problems to improve their quality of life and stay connected with their world and loved ones.
I have been very fortunate in receiving a broad education at one of the nation’s best residency training programs. This has enabled me to expertly address the full spectrum of otolaryngologic disorders. Within this broader practice, I have specific interests in the medical and surgical treatment of nasal and sinus disorders, allergic disease, ear and hearing problems, skin lesions, and thyroid conditions.
My patients and I are a team, united in our common goal of maximizing their ENT quality of life. It is in this spirit that I always approach their problems, infused with empathy and a determination to ensure that each patient fully understands their condition and treatment options. I believe that delivering the best medicine requires not only deep medical knowledge and excellent surgical skills, but also a caring and safe environment through which a trusting relationship can be formed.”
